No description
Иерархия: transport → provider → model → profile. Поле `transport`: direct-api — прямой HTTP к провайдеру aws-bedrock — AWS Bedrock (IAM/role + region) azure-openai — Azure OpenAI (deployment + key) google-vertex — GCP Vertex AI (service-account JSON) local — Ollama / MLX / LM Studio proxy — LiteLLM / OpenRouter subscription — ChatGPT OAuth (Codex) Новые провайдеры: - anthropic-bedrock — Claude через AWS - openai-azure — GPT через Azure - google-vertex — Gemini через Vertex - openrouter — multi-provider proxy Существующие провайдеры получили transport-тег. Используется install/lib-onboarding.sh для интерактивного мастера выбора language → transport → provider → model → credentials. 14 провайдеров суммарно: 5 direct-api + 1 aws + 1 azure + 1 vertex + 3 local + 2 proxy + 1 subscription. |
||
|---|---|---|
| agent-profiles.toml | ||
| models.toml | ||
| providers.toml | ||
| README.md | ||
kei-registries
Единый источник истины для three-layer DNA:
- providers.toml — LLM-провайдеры (anthropic / openai / xai / deepseek / google + локальные)
- models.toml — конкретные модели с ценами и контекстом
- agent-profiles.toml — публичные роли (юзер выбирает в marketplace, добавляет свой ключ)
Подключается как submodule в:
KeiSeiLab/KeiSeiKit-1.0→_blocks/registries/(kei-model-router читает)keisei-marketplace→_blocks/registries/(Next.js loader читает)
Что НЕ здесь
ml-implementer, ml-researcher, physics-deriver, cartoon-studio, keisei-os,
patent-compliance — приватные/IP-связанные, лежат локально в ~/.claude/agents/.